Well you never know what you're going to find... in the handover to our new Parish Clerk I've been helping move some paperwork into storage. Before it goes, however, it's good to just glance through the piles and piles of boxes before they go. This popped up!

During the second world war, civil communities would save up and adopt a warship during "Warship Week". It appears Charfield saved quite well, and afforded HMS Severn, which as far as I can see was a River class submarine! Here's a picture.

The paperless office has much to offer. We have to keep a lot of paper and we have no space for it unless it goes into commercial storage - at which point it's also very hard to look at! I've scanned a lot of old parchment and other interesting bits. 

Things like this historic item are interesting rather than crucial to the running of a parish council, but they're fun to have. I wonder if anyone will actually look at the physical certificate in the next century or so...
